Den mest komplette guide til kravstyring og sporbarhed
Kravsporbarhed: Links i kravkæden
Indholdsfortegnelse
Krav Afledning
For pålidelig sporbarhed af afledte krav skal hvert krav være klart identificeret og sporet gennem hele projektet ved hjælp af en unik og vedvarende etiket. Det er mere ønskeligt at bruge ét centraliseret, moderniseret kravstyringssystem end flere separate dokumenter til dette formål.
Et kravstyringsværktøj tilbyder et centraliseret, praktisk sted til at indsamle feedback og øjeblikkeligt samarbejde om anmeldelser og godkendelser. Den samme software giver sporbarhed i realtid af alle upstream- og downstream-relationer, hvilket giver dig et klart overblik over, hvilken effekt ændringer har på krav på alle niveauer såvel som testdækning. Som sådan kan projekthold relativt let oprette fire forskellige typer sporingslinks til deres afledte krav.
De fire typer afledte krav Sporbarhed
Frem mod krav – Efterhånden som kundernes krav udvikler sig, skal projektteams justere deres krav for at holde trit med ændringer i kundernes prioriteter og indførelse eller ændring af forretningsregler. Disse finjusterede revisioner hjælper med at sikre, at projekter reagerer tilstrækkeligt på ændringer i et landskab i konstant udvikling.
Baglæns FRA-krav - Ved at spore tilbage fra de fastsatte krav, kan man få en bedre forståelse af, hvor hvert behov stammer fra. For eksempel vil udnyttelse af et effektivt værktøj til kravstyring demonstrere, hvordan det afledte krav er knyttet til dets oprindelse, og hvilken kundeanvendelse det arbejder hen imod at opfylde.
Forward FROM Krav – Efterhånden som produktudviklingen skrider frem, bliver det muligt at spore kravene tilbage til deres tilsvarende elementer. Denne form for link giver bekræftelse på, at hvert krav er opfyldt af en given komponent. Etablering af denne forbindelse sikrer, at produkter bliver bygget op til brugernes forventninger og specifikationer.
Baglæns MOD krav – Ved at forstå rationalet bag specifikke kodelinjer giver denne type link indsigt i, hvorfor visse funktioner blev designet. På trods af at nogle stykker kode måske ikke stemmer overens med interessenternes forventninger, er det vigtigt at erkende, hvorfor en softwareingeniør valgte at inkludere dem i applikationen.
De vigtigste motiver for sporbarhed af afledte krav
Sporbarhed spiller en afgørende rolle i at skabe en effektiv produktlivscyklus og avanceret projektstyring. Mere detaljerede fordele ved at inkorporere sporbarhed omfatter:
Certificeringer – Ved at verificere, at alle påkrævede betingelser var opfyldt, kan sporbarhedsdata bevise sikkerheden og integriteten af certificerede produkter.
Effektanalyse – Ved omhyggeligt at følge ethvert krav, der er afledt af en ændring, er der mindre sandsynlighed for at gå glip af detaljer, der kan have en indflydelse. Dette sikrer nøjagtigheden og fuldstændigheden af alle kravsporingsindsatser.
Vedligeholdelse - Anvendelse af et moderne kravstyringsværktøj til at sikre tydelig sporbarhed gør vedligeholdelse ubesværet, da ændringer (såsom at reagere på ændringer i lovbestemmelser eller virksomhedspolitikker) kan forfølges med absolut sikkerhed. Dette system giver brugerne mulighed for hurtigt at identificere eventuelle relevante regler, der er blevet behandlet i de påkrævede dokumenter.
Projektsporing – Sporbarhedsoplysninger er et uigendriveligt dokument, der skitserer fremskridtene for planlagt funktionalitet; hvis der mangler links, betyder det, at der ikke er lavet arbejdsprodukter.
Re-engineering – For at sikre en gnidningsløs overgang fra et forældet system til det nye skal du liste alle funktionerne i det gamle system og spore dem i kravene og softwarekomponenterne til dets erstatning. Registrer disse data til referenceformål.
Genbrug – Ved at implementere sporbarhed af afledte krav kan vi identificere og genbruge produktkomponenter mere effektivt. Dette inkluderer relaterede pakker med specifikationer, design, kode og test for nem genbrug.
Risikoreduktion – Detaljeret dokumentation af komponentforbindelser kan reducere faren, der følger med at miste et værdifuldt teammedlem, som har væsentlig viden om systemet.
Testning - Sammenkobling af krav, test og kode kan guide os til de potentielle kilder til fejl, når vi modtager et uforudset testresultat. Desuden vil en forståelse af, hvilke test der er relateret til hvilke specifikationer, give en stor fordel ved at tillade sletning af unødvendige kontroller.
Formål med krav Sporbarhed
Formålet med kravsporbarhed er at sikre, at alle relevante interessenter er udstyret med de nødvendige ressourcer til validering, styring og sporing af produktudviklingens fremskridt. Dette omfattende system hjælper os med at forstå, hvilke dele af et produkt, der er bygget ud fra hvilke krav, og hvordan disse komponenter understøtter hinanden. Ud over at give indsigt i forskellige udviklingsstadier, beskytter det organisationer mod potentielle risici ved at bekræfte, at afledte krav blev behandlet korrekt. Sporbarhed tjener også som et læringsværktøj til at forbedre fremtidige projekter ved at give synlighed om tidligere succeser og fiaskoer; dette giver teams mulighed for at træffe bedre beslutninger, når de fastlægger projektprioriteter. Endelig kan det hjælpe med at reducere omkostningerne, da unødvendigt arbejde kan undgås gennem genbrug af eksisterende komponenter.
Udfordringer med kravsporbarhed
Mens kravsporbarhed kan hjælpe med at optimere processer og reducere omkostninger, er det ikke uden sit eget sæt af udfordringer. For eksempel kan manglen på korrekt kobling mellem krav føre til væsentlige fejl under produktudviklingen; Det kræver dog en betydelig mængde tid og kræfter at sikre, at alle komponenter er forbundet. De mest almindelige omfatter:
- Manglende standardisering: Uden en standardiseret sporbarhedsramme er det svært at sikre, at alle komponenter er forbundet. Dette kan føre til fejlkommunikation mellem interessenter, såvel som overskredne deadlines og uforudsete fejl.
- Manuel sporing: Hvis manuelle processer bruges til sporingskrav, er der øget risiko for menneskelige fejl og ineffektivitet. Derudover kan det være tidskrævende og kedeligt at holde styr på ændringer manuelt i stedet for automatisk at bruge softwareværktøjer designet specifikt til dette formål.
- Dårlig dokumentation: Dokumentation af lav kvalitet fører til forvirring, når man forsøger at forstå de forskellige krav; hvis vigtige detaljer ikke registreres nøjagtigt, kan det reducere effektiviteten af sporbarhedsindsatsen betydeligt. Ydermere kan utilstrækkelig dokumentation resultere i, at det forkerte produkt bliver bygget.
- Omkostninger: Implementering af et sporbarhedssystem kræver betydelige ressourcer, hvilket kan være svært at retfærdiggøre, hvis det ikke udnyttes korrekt. Derudover bør omkostningerne til vedligeholdelse og vedligeholdelse også indregnes i enhver beslutning, der involverer kravsporbarhed.
- Forandringsledelse: Da kravene udvikler sig i løbet af produktudviklingen, er det nødvendigt at opdatere sporbarhedslinks i overensstemmelse hermed. Dette kan være en vanskelig og tidskrævende proces, hvis det ikke gribes an på en organiseret måde.
- Forkert administrationsværktøj: På trods af tilgængeligheden af forskellige softwareværktøjer er mange organisationer stadig afhængige af manuelle processer til at styre sporbarhed. Dette kan føre til betydelige forsinkelser og fejl, hvis det ikke administreres korrekt.
Visure Krav ALM Platform
Visure er en af de mest betroede ALM-platforme, der specialiserer sig i kravstyring for organisationer af alle størrelser over hele kloden. Det er fleksibelt og fuldstændig i stand til at strømline kravprocesserne, hvilket muliggør et bedre, mere effektivt og mere samarbejdende arbejdsmiljø. Dataanalytikere kan skabe relationer, generere hierarkier, administrere sporbarhed og automatisk fange krav fra MS Excel, Outlook og MS Word. Visure understøtter standardoverholdelsesskabeloner for ISO 26262, IEC 62304, IEC 61508, CENELEC 50128, DO-178B/C, FMEA, SPICE, CMMI osv. Platformen integreres med flere tredjepartsløsninger, såsom Accompa, Jira, MS Sharepoint , og Salesforce.
Visures revolutionerende krav ALM-platform sikrer, at du får realtidsadgang til et sporbarhedsdashboard, der giver et dybdegående overblik over de varer, der spores eller ikke spores. Dette enestående værktøj giver mulighed for fuld håndhævelse på ethvert niveau – fra kunde- og softwarekrav helt ned til mekaniske detaljer, risikovurdering og test. Lås op for synlighed i dit projekt i dag med Visure!
Konklusion
Krav sporbarhed er en væsentlig del af enhver softwareudviklingsproces og kan hjælpe med at strømline produktudvikling, reducere omkostninger og optimere processer. Det er dog ikke uden sit eget sæt af udfordringer, såsom manglende standardisering, manuel sporing, dårlig dokumentation, omkostningsproblemer, ændringsstyring og ukorrekte styringsværktøjer. Visure Krav ALM Platform leverer en omfattende løsning til styring af kravsporbarhed – der sikrer realtidsadgang til et sporbarhedsdashboard med fuld håndhævelse på ethvert niveau. Brug af denne kraftfulde platform vil gøre det muligt for organisationer at nå deres mål og samtidig eliminere risiciene forbundet med traditionelle kravsporingsteknikker.
Glem ikke at dele dette opslag!
Begynd at få ende-til-ende-sporbarhed på tværs af dine projekter med Visure i dag
Start 30-dages gratis prøveperiode i dag!